If you are running a cm7 rom you can theme your phone with ics and make it look like ics. At the moment there is NO ics rom. Only ics themed gingerbread rom's. LG will NOT be updating the optimus with ics,but the cyanogen team (responsible for our wonderful cm7 roms) will he eventually making a cm9 ics rom for us to use. So the bottom line is that we'll get ics, but it will take longer because LG didn't make it super easy for us to get it by making us one:p
